摘要:

建立了液态水基类化妆品中22种性激素的超高效液相色谱分析方法。样品经80%乙腈水溶液超声提取,离心后上清液经PRiME HLB固相萃取柱净化。采用CORTECS C18+ (2.1 mm×100 mm,2.7 μm)色谱柱分离,以乙腈-水为流动相进行梯度洗脱,PDA检测器多波长检测,外标法定量。结果表明,22种性激素在各自的质量浓度范围内线性关系良好(相关系数r>0.99),检出限(LOD)和定量下限(LOQ)分别为0.03~0.1 μg/mL和0.1~0.4 μg/mL。在5,25和50 μg/g 3个加标水平下的回收率为80.3%~99.6%,相对标准偏差(RSD,n=6)为0.3%~7.7%。该方法前处理简单、灵敏度高、准确性好,适用于液态水基类化妆品中性激素的测定。

Abstract:

An ultra-high performance liquid chromatography method was established for determination of 22 sex hormones in water-based cosmetics. The sample was ultrasonically extracted with 80% acetonitrile solution. After centrifugation, the supernatant was purified by PRiME HLB column. Chromatographic separation was achieved on an CORTECS C18+ (2.1 mm×100 mm, 2.7 μm) column by gradient elution using acetonitrile-water as mobile phases. PDA detector was used to test samples by multiple wavelengths, and external standard method was used for quantification. The results show that there are good linear relationships for 22 sex hormones in the respective concentration range with their correlation coefficients (r) all above 0.99. The limits of detection (LOD) and limits of quantitation (LOQ) for 22 sex hormones are in the range of 0.03-0.1 μg/mL and 0.1-0.4 μg/mL, respectively. Average recoveries at three levels of 5,25,50 μg/g are in the range of 80.3%-99.6%, with relative standard deviations(RSD, n=6) of 0.3%-7.7%. With the advantages of simplicity, sensitivity and accuracy, this method is suitable for the analysis of sex hormones in water-based cosmetics.
